- The distance between Tiffin, Oh, Usa and Concepcion-Carriel Sur, Chile is approximately 8,722 km or 5,420 mi.
- To reach Tiffin, Oh in this distance one would set out from Concepcion-Carriel Sur bearing 352.2°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Tiffin, Oh bearing 351.7° or N .
- Tiffin, Oh has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Concepcion-Carriel Sur has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- The mean temperature is 2.6 °C (4.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20 °C (36°F) more in Tiffin, Oh.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 185.5 mm (7.3 in) less which is equivalent to 185.5 l/m² (4.55 US gal/ft²) or 1,855,000 l/ha (198,312 US gal/ac) less. About 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.6° lower in Tiffin, Oh than in Concepcion-Carriel Sur.
